I highly recommend setting a future test date and then going by the schedule they provide. What I did was crammed all the material watched the videos on double speed and took tons and tons of practice exams. I went back through and focused my practice questions on topics I didn’t understand by using the customize option. As I reviewed both the exams and quizzes I noted heavily and made up funny words and phrases to remember things. For coupon rate for instance I said “noupon rate” that way I could remember nominal = coupon rate. FOCUS ON THE EXAM READINESS. Mine ended the day before at a 96% and I was pleased to find that the exam was easier than I expected because of heavy preparation. On the day of the exam, dress nice, eat breakfast (when debating on whether to eat breakfast my wife said “breakfast is the most important meal of the day”), and walk in their like the financial expert you are. Confidence is key. Flag anything you absolutely don’t know and answer everything you’re confident on. At the end go back through take one last guess on the ones you flagged and send it! You got this.
